Abstract

An anti-loosening device of a power plug comprises at least a pluggable limiting piece and a power socket matched therewith. A limiting guide slot corresponding to the shape and the position of the limiting piece is formed on the upper surface of the power socket; the limiting piece comprises two opposite guide slots symmetrically formed on two arbitrary side edges on the upper surface of the power socket; the two guide slots are formed by a straight edge formed by extending upwards from the upper surface of the power socket and a folded edge folded from the top end of the straight edge to the inner side thereof; and the limiting piece is clamped in the limiting guide slot on the power socket after the power plug is inserted into the power socket, so as to restrain the power plug from moving to the direction opposite to the power socket. The invention can effectively prevent the looseness or the fall-off of the power plug caused by external force in use, keep the consistency of the prior structure and the shape of the power plug and the power socket, and has the advantages of simple structure, convenient and quick plugging, easy implementation and wide popularization.

Description

The anti-loosing device of attaching plug
[technical field]
The present invention relates to be used for the attaching plug of power source conversion, particularly relate to a kind of can after attaching plug inserts supply socket, being fixed, to prevent the anti-loosing device of loosening or the attaching plug that comes off.
[background technology]
As everyone knows, attaching plug is the power source conversion device that connects power supply and power consumption equipment, and it also is one of the most frequently used device of electric equipment.Between PDU (Power Distribution Unit power distribution unit) or supply socket and attaching plug, need realize being connected with the grafting of socket by plug.Attaching plug and supply socket at present generally the inserting mode of employing be direct grafting substantially, though it can satisfy user's general requirement, but still have following open defect:
1, after attaching plug inserts supply socket, as when running into plug and being rocked, produces loose contact with socket easily, thereby may take place: A, make power supply or power supply output pause occur; B, produce instantaneous spike and disturb, influence the operate as normal of power consumption equipment or instrument, in the time of seriously even power consumption equipment or instrument that damage connected; C, cause the deadlock of systems such as the computer that moving, communication, information;
2, attaching plug is subjected to making it loosening with contacting of supply socket easily after the external force collision, thereby might cause powering or interruption that power supply is exported;
3, attaching plug is subjected to after the strong external force collision it being come off from socket, thereby might produce the outage phenomenon;
When 4, above-mentioned any situation no matter occurring, all may make system or equipment instruments such as the computer that moving, communication, information cause serious damage, and may cause great liability accident and immeasurable economic loss;
At present, hi-tech developments such as computer, communication, network are rapid, the application of these new technologies and new equipment is without exception too busy to get away power supply all, and power supply and power consumption equipment or instrument be connected that the grafting that is by attaching plug and supply socket realizes, therefore, safe and reliable connected mode is most important, especially how guaranteeing that attaching plug inserts can connect firmly after the supply socket and can not become flexible or come off, and is the important Electrical Safety problem that worldwide professional person institute ten minutes is concerned about and is faced.

[embodiment]
The following example is to further explanation of the present invention and explanation, and the present invention is not constituted any limitation.
Consult Fig. 1, Fig. 2, the anti-loosing device of attaching plug of the present invention comprises locating part 10, supply socket 20, limit guide groove 30 and attaching plug 40, described supply socket 20 can be computer or industrial IEC320 C13 or IEC320 C19 type socket etc., is industrial IEC320 C13 or IEC320 C19 type socket in this example.As Fig. 2, on the upper surface of supply socket 20, be provided with limit guide groove 30, this limit guide groove comprises two guide grooves 31,32, and their symmetries and be arranged on the edge of any both sides on supply socket 20 upper surfaces opposite to each other are the edge of both sides along its length in this example.Specifically, article two, guide groove the 31, the 32nd, is roughly L shaped guide groove by what straight flange 311,321 and flanging 312,322 constituted, wherein, described straight flange the 311, the 321st extends upward and forms from supply socket 20 upper surfaces, flanging 312,322 is folded to the inboard by the straight flange top and forms, and two flanging slightly is inclined upwardly, and makes its outer surface form the inclined-plane.Article two, guide groove 31,32 is positioned at the middle part at edge of its place one side of supply socket upper surface, and the plane in its outside, both ends is used to install locating part 10.
Referring to Fig. 2, Fig. 3, the attaching plug 40 in this example is IEC320 C14 or IEC320 C20 type attaching plug, is provided with first limited step 41 around its side surface on the side surface of this attaching plug, and it is the upper dimension of attaching plug is dwindled and to form.This first limited step is relative with limit guide groove 30 positions in the supply socket after attaching plug 40 inserts supply socket 20.
As Fig. 2, shown in Figure 3, main points of the present invention are, but be provided with the locating part 10 of two plugs, this locating part is connected in after attaching plug 40 inserts supply sockets 20 in the limit guide groove 30 in the supply socket, with restriction attaching plug 40 to breaking away from moving of supply socket 20 directions.Locating part 10 structures are shown in Fig. 4 A, Fig. 4 B, and it is one and is separated with attaching plug and supply socket, but the plug part of the use of after attaching plug inserts supply socket, just pegging graft, and it is made by plastic material.This locating part 10 takes the shape of the letter U, and it is made of two position limit arms 11,12 and the horizontal edge 13 of being located at two position limit arm ends, and two position limit arms 11,12 can form socket connections with the guide groove 31,32 in the supply socket 20.As Fig. 4 A, in the outside of two position limit arms 11,12 a L shaped breach 111,121 is arranged respectively, the width of this breach 111,121 is corresponding with flanging 312,322 width of the guide groove of supply socket 31,32.Respectively be provided with the shell fragment 112,122 that a clamping is used in two indentation, there by the bottom, the guide groove 31,32 of the size of two shell fragments and shape and supply socket matches, it is to have U-shaped breach 1141,1241 and form on the rank of breach bottom shape face 114,124, and the U-shaped breach makes shell fragment 112,122 elastically deformables.The end of two shell fragments respectively has a location of protruding laterally to collude 1121,1221,1121,1221 guide grooves 31,32 that protrude in supply socket when shell fragment 112,122 is in static state are colluded in two location, and the position limit arm 11,12 of locating part can not be packed in the supply socket.Because the size of shell fragment 112,122 is much smaller than position limit arm 11,12, and has elasticity, therefore can produce displacement to the direction of U-shaped breach 1141,1241.When locating part 10 was packed supply socket 20 into, available external force is light pressed two shell fragments 112,122 or one of them, it is inwardly shunk and two shell fragments 112,122 of locating part 10 are inserted in the guide groove 31,32 of supply sockets.Corresponding with it, straight flange 311,321 middle inside of the guide groove 31,32 in supply socket 20 respectively are provided with a detent 3111,3211.When two shell fragments, 112,122 grafting of locating part 10 put in place, the location on two shell fragments 112,122 was colluded 1121,1221 and is just fallen into described detent 3111,3211, the location of having realized locating part 10 by elasticity.
As Fig. 4 B, be provided with second a L shaped limited step 14 in the inboard of two position limit arms 11,12 and horizontal edge 13 by the middle and lower part, this second limited step is on first limited step 41 that is pressed on after the locating part 10 insertion supply sockets 20 on the attaching plug 40.
Referring to Fig. 1, in order behind the locating part of packing into, to keep itself and supply socket 20 and attaching plug 40 at profile and consistency on the whole and aesthetic property, the outer surface of locating part 10 has radian consistent with the outer surface of supply socket 20 or gradient, make locating part 10 after inserting supply socket 20, its upper surface is concordant with two guide grooves, 31,32 upper surfaces, and the outer surface of its horizontal edge 13 is concordant with the outer surface of supply socket 20.
As Fig. 4 A, for the ease of unloading locating part 10 when the plug attaching plug 40, be provided with breach 131 at horizontal edge 13 upsides of locating part 10, there is finger tip to scratch indentation, there and can extracts locating part.
Operation principle of the present invention such as Fig. 2, shown in Figure 3, Fig. 2 have shown the released state of each parts.As Fig. 3, after attaching plug 40 insertion supply sockets 20, the limited step 41 on the attaching plug 40 is just in time relative with limit guide groove 30 positions in the supply socket.Then two locating parts 10 are inserted from the both sides of supply socket 20.In the insertion, the shell fragment 112,122 of two locating parts 10 slides in the guide groove 31,32 of supply socket 20, the main body of two position limit arm 11,12 inboards is slided between guide groove 31,32 and attaching plug 40, locating part 10 inserts when putting in place, the minor face of the breach 111,121 of locating part just contacts with the end face of guide groove 31,32, simultaneously, 1121,1221 detents 3111,3211 that just fall into guide groove 31,32 inboards are colluded in the location on the shell fragment of two locating parts 10, with locating part 10 location.Second limited step 14 of locating part downside then is pressed on first limited step 41 on the attaching plug 40, and limited attaching plug 40 fully to breaking away from moving of supply socket 20 directions, therefore also fundamentally eliminated the possibility becoming flexible or come off of attaching plug after the supply socket of packing into.
